/**
* Find the issuer of input in allCerts. If the input has an
* AuthorityKeyIdentifier extension and the keyId inside matches
* the keyId of the SubjectKeyIdentifier of a cert. This cert is
* returned. Otherwise, a cert whose subjectDN is the same as the
* input's issuerDN is returned.
*
* @param input the input certificate
* @return the isssuer, or null if none matches
*/
private X509Certificate findIssuer(X509Certificate input) {
X509Certificate fallback = null; // the DN match
X500Principal issuerPrinc = input.getIssuerX500Principal();
// AuthorityKeyIdentifier value encoded as an OCTET STRING
byte[] issuerIdExtension = input.getExtensionValue("2.5.29.35");
byte[] issuerId = null;
if (issuerIdExtension != null) {
try {
issuerId = new AuthorityKeyIdentifierExtension(
false,
new DerValue(issuerIdExtension).getOctetString())
.getEncodedKeyIdentifier();
} catch (IOException e) {
// ignored. issuerId is still null
}
}
for (X509Certificate cert : allCerts) {
if (cert.getSubjectX500Principal().equals(issuerPrinc)) {
if (issuerId != null) {
// SubjectKeyIdentifier value encoded as an OCTET STRING
byte[] subjectIdExtension = cert.getExtensionValue("2.5.29.14");
byte[] subjectId = null;
if (subjectIdExtension != null) {
try {
subjectId = new DerValue(subjectIdExtension)
.getOctetString();
} catch (IOException e) {
// ignored. issuerId is still null
}
}
if (subjectId != null) {
if (Arrays.equals(issuerId, subjectId)) {
// keyId exact match!
return cert;
} else {
// Different keyId. Not a fallback.
continue;
}
} else {
// A DN match with no subjectId
fallback = cert;
}
} else { // if there is no issuerId, return the 1st DN match
return cert;
}
}
}
return fallback;
}
